Hey Everyone, I recently had a problem with my Jeep running very rich and not running quite right. Well that was finally fixed last night when a hole in the vacuum line to the M.A.P sensor was discovered. Went and started it up for the first time since I fixed the vacuum line, and it fired up quicker than normal and isn't running rich anymore, but now it has a fluctuating idle. It will idle between 900 and 2,700 RPM now. If I disconnect the M.A.P vacuum line, it goes back to how it used to be and idles, but runs very richly. Does anyone know whats going on? Thanks, Gary



You have another vacuum leak from those symptoms. Something like the purge valve on the old style canister going bad would cause that or a bad EGR.
